Seaside unfolds along a stretch of California's Central Coast where the Pacific breathes a cool, salty air onto rolling hills and flatlands. It lies 2.9 miles east-north-east of Monterey, CA (from Monterey, CA: bearing 75°T), and is situated 5.6 miles south-south-west of Marina. Its geography, a gentle slope from the coastal mountains towards the vast expanse of Monterey Bay, has shaped its history from humble beginnings as agricultural land to a vibrant community. The economy, historically rooted in farming and fishing, now thrives on tourism and a growing service sector, drawing people to its accessible shores and lively atmosphere.
